Types of Doors and Windows
Comprehending the different types of windows and doors available can help property owners make notified decisions matched to their needs:
Doors
Entry Doors: The main exterior of your home, entry doors been available in numerous materials, such as wood, fiberglass, and steel. They supply security and set the tone for your home's exterior.
Interior Doors: These doors different spaces and add personal privacy. Designs include hinged, sliding, and bi-fold doors, offered in a number of designs and materials.
Patio area Doors: Ideal for linking indoor and outdoor areas, these consist of sliding glass doors, French doors, and accordion doors.
Storm Doors: Added beyond main doors, storm doors offer additional security against weather components while enhancing insulation.
Windows
Double-Hung Windows: Features 2 sashes (the parts that hold the glass) that move vertically, permitting adaptability in ventilation.
Casement Windows: Hinged on one side, these windows open outward, offering unblocked views and outstanding ventilation.
Image Windows: Fixed windows that do not open, best for showcasing views and natural light.
Sliding Windows: These windows slide open horizontally, making them ideal for smaller sized spaces.
Bay and Bow Windows: Extend out from the home, creating additional area inside and boosting external aesthetics.
Elements to Consider When Choosing Doors and Windows
Before devoting to new doors and windows, house owners ought to think about numerous crucial factors to guarantee they choose the best choices for their homes:
Material: Consider resilience, maintenance, and insulation homes. Typical materials include wood, vinyl, aluminum, and fiberglass.
Energy Efficiency: Look for energy-star-rated items to lower heating and cooling expenses. Low-E glass can decrease energy loss.
Designs and Designs: The style of windows and doors ought to complement the home's architecture and individual style.
Security Features: Prioritize features such as strong locks, tempered glass, and strong construction to enhance security.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I understand if my windows and doors require replacing?
- Indications consist of drafts, noticeable damage, problem opening or closing, moisture in between glass panes, and extreme energy expenses.
2. What is the typical expense of new windows and doors?
- Expenses differ based on size, product, and installation, however you can anticipate to pay between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window or door.
3. For how long does setup take?
- Installation times differ depending on the job size, however typically, changing a single door or window takes a couple of hours. Full home replacements might take numerous days.
4.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
- Yes, they can result in considerable long-term cost savings on energy bills and improve indoor comfort.
5. Do I need to hire a professional for setup?
- While some skilled DIYers can deal with door and window replacements, working with an expert makes sure proper installation and adherence to building regulations.
